The original owner of this car was Senator T. Newell Woods of Pennsylvania. The SCCA 'Bryfan Tydden' Road Races were run on a course around his estate in the early 1950s.
It was restored by the current owner in 2007 and ran VSCCA races including Pocono and Pittsburgh. The drivers, since restoration, have included Dick Irish, Formula III Champion in the early 1950s, and Nigel Ashman, Formula III Champion of England in 2001.
